What You’ll Do:
The Senior Mechanical Design Engineer will provide guidance for design and prototype builds for the Space Kinetic core technology to achieve our mission of a flight demo within the next 2 years in a fast-paced startup environment. Design and develop system and subsystem assemblies, mechanisms and moving assemblies including linkages, gears, cams, actuators, and precision motion systems. Perform mechanism design, tolerance analysis, and kinematic studies to ensure reliable operation. Create 3D CAD models, assemblies, and engineering drawings using tools such as SolidWorks, Creo, CATIA or NX. Support the mechanical simulations and FEA teams creating step files, simplified reps and volumes to assist with the modeling to validate strength, fatigue, and functional performance. Design and develop prototype assemblies and test mechanisms to validate functionality and operational stability. Work with and support cross-functional teams including simulation, electrical, manufacturing, and systems engineering. Support design for manufacturing (DFM) and design for assembly (DFA) initiatives to drive down cost and schedule. Prepare technical documentation, test plans, and support design reviews.
Key Responsibilities:
Mechanism Development
- Design and develop space-rated mechanisms, including:
- Release and separation systems
- Motorized actuators and gear trains
- Payload pointing mechanisms
- Precision robotic or kinematic mechanisms
- Mechanism torque and friction calculations
- Select appropriate space-qualified materials, lubricants, bearings, and coatings.
- Support finite element analysis (FEA) and mechanism performance simulations.
Prototyping & Testing
- Support development of hardware design and builds as well as prototype testing.
- Investigate functional test anomalies and implement corrective design changes.
- Lead mechanical support for environmental testing, including:
- Thermal Vacuum (TVAC)
- Random vibration
- Shock testing
- Deployment testing
Manufacturing & Integration
- Work closely with manufacturing and producibility teams to ensure designs are producible and testable.
- Support assembly, integration, and test (AIT) of spacecraft hardware.
- Provide hands-on support during payload integration and spacecraft assembly.
Documentation & Reviews
- Follow design and hardware I&T processes
- Generate and maintain engineering documentation, including:
- Mechanical design packages
- Interface Control Documents (ICDs)
- Assembly procedures
- Test plans and reports
- Present designs during major program reviews:
- SRR (System Requirements Review)
- PDR (Preliminary Design Review)
- CDR (Critical Design Review)
- TRR (Test Readiness Review)

What you need to know about the Los Angeles Tech Scene
Key Facts About Los Angeles Tech
- Number of Tech Workers: 375,800; 5.5% of overall workforce (2024 CompTIA survey)
- Major Tech Employers: Snap, Netflix, SpaceX, Disney, Google
- Key Industries: Artificial intelligence, adtech, media, software, game development
- Funding Landscape: $11.6 billion in venture capital funding in 2024 (Pitchbook)
- Notable Investors: Strong Ventures, Fifth Wall, Upfront Ventures, Mucker Capital, Kittyhawk Ventures
- Research Centers and Universities: California Institute of Technology, UCLA, University of Southern California, UC Irvine, Pepperdine, California Institute for Immunology and Immunotherapy, Center for Quantum Science and Engineering
